The Science Behind Cold Air and Tire Pressure

The air inside your tires, like all gases, expands when heated and contracts when cooled. This principle, known as thermal expansion, is directly related to the kinetic energy of the gas molecules. When the temperature rises, the molecules move faster, colliding more frequently and exerting greater pressure on the tire walls. Conversely, when the temperature drops, the molecules slow down, resulting in less pressure.

How Temperature Affects Tire Pressure

The relationship between temperature and tire pressure is not linear. For every 10-degree Fahrenheit drop in temperature, tire pressure can decrease by approximately 1 pound per square inch (psi). This means that on a cold winter day, your tire pressure could be significantly lower than it was on a warm summer day, even if you haven’t lost any air.

Maintaining Proper Tire Pressure

Given the impact of temperature on tire pressure, it’s crucial to regularly check and adjust your tire pressure, especially during seasonal changes. (See Also: Who Owns Firestone Tires? The Surprising Truth)

Checking Tire Pressure

You can check your tire pressure using a reliable tire pressure gauge. It’s best to check your tires when they are cold, meaning they haven’t been driven for at least three hours. This ensures an accurate reading, as driving generates heat and can temporarily increase tire pressure.

Adjusting Tire Pressure

Once you have checked your tire pressure, compare it to the recommended pressure listed in your vehicle’s owner’s manual or on a sticker located on the driver’s side doorjamb. Adjust the pressure accordingly using an air compressor. Remember to add or release air in small increments and recheck the pressure frequently until you reach the desired level.

The Importance of Proper Tire Pressure

Maintaining proper tire pressure is essential for several reasons:

Safety

Underinflated tires increase the risk of blowouts, especially during high-speed driving or cornering. They also reduce traction, making it harder to stop or control your vehicle, particularly in wet or icy conditions. Overinflated tires, on the other hand, can lead to a loss of control, especially during sudden maneuvers.

Fuel Efficiency

Underinflated tires create more rolling resistance, which forces your engine to work harder and consume more fuel. Properly inflated tires reduce rolling resistance, improving fuel economy.

Tire Wear

FAQs

What is the best time of day to check tire pressure?

The best time to check tire pressure is in the morning or after your vehicle has been parked for at least three hours. This ensures the tires are cold, providing an accurate reading.

How much should I adjust tire pressure in cold weather?

For every 10-degree Fahrenheit drop in temperature, tire pressure can decrease by approximately 1 psi. It’s recommended to add air to your tires to compensate for this pressure loss.
